Zoning
HDR
High Density Residential
The High Density Residential zone is primarily for multi-family development at densities of greater than 15 dwelling units per acre. High-density residential zones are usually located near transit services, shopping and major transportation routes. Cluster development, zero lot-line housing and other incentives are permitted to promote infill and preservation of open space. Offices are permitted in the HDR zone in order to provide some of the service needs generated by high-intensity land uses.
